package org.apache.felix.dependencymanager;
/**
* Generic dependency for a service. A dependency can be required or not.
* A dependency will be activated by the service it belongs to. The service
* will call the <code>start(Service service)</code> and
* <code>stop(Service service)</code> methods.
*
* After it has been started, a dependency must callback
* the associated service's <code>dependencyAvailable()</code> and
* <code>dependencyUnavailable()</code>
* methods. State changes of the dependency itself may only be made as long as
* the dependency is not 'active', meaning it is associated with a running service.
*
* @author <a href="mailto:dev@felix.apache.org">Felix Project Team</a>
*/
public interface Dependency {
/**
* Returns <code>true</code> if this a required dependency. Required dependencies
* are dependencies that must be available before the service can be activated.
*
* @return <code>true</code> if the dependency is required
*/
public boolean isRequired();
/**
* Returns <code>true</code> if the dependency is available.
*
* @return <code>true</code> if the dependency is available
*/
public boolean isAvailable();
/**
* Starts tracking the dependency. This activates some implementation
* specific mechanism to do the actual tracking. If the tracking discovers
* that the dependency becomes available, it should call
* <code>dependencyAvailable()</code> on the service.
*
* @param service the service that is associated with this dependency
*/
public void start(Service service);
/**
* Stops tracking the dependency. This deactivates the tracking. If the
* dependency was available, the tracker should call
* <code>dependencyUnavaible()</code> before stopping itself to ensure
* that dependencies that aren't "active" are unavailable.
*/
public void stop(Service service);
}
